Music has fundamentally changed in many ways. Here is one. polar Levine writes "Suiting Up The Music: The Industry's Reframing Of Music's Role In Society" He covers how the corporatization of music has moved it away from the realm of art and creativity. It's come to resemble competitive sports and assembly-line piecework.
Polar writes:
"It's not illegal downloading that will cause the fall of the music industry as we know it; it's the industry's enslavement to inside-the-box thinking. The industry is aping America's Big Three auto companies' descent into oblivion for the same reasons — the inclination to invest in lawsuits and lobbyists instead of looking toward the future and investing in creativity."
